RIB® Dry Contact Input Relay RIB02SBCDC Enclosed 208-277VAC 20A SPDT Override

The RIB02SBCDC Enclosed Relay is a versatile solution for a wide range of applications, including building automation, industrial control, and energy management. Its dry contact input can be activated by various devices such as thermostats, switches, and other relays, making it a flexible and adaptable component. The relay is self-powered, requiring only a low-voltage power source, and features isolated contacts that can switch any power or low-voltage load. With its compact design and wide voltage range, this relay is ideal for use in various settings, from commercial buildings to industrial facilities, and can be used to control lighting, HVAC systems, and other loads.

Top product features:

  • The dry contact input relay can be activated by a wide range of dry-contacts such as thermostats, switches, other relays, and solid-state switches.
  • The relay provides the low-voltage (class power needed to activate the relay, allowing it to be self-powered.
  • The relay contacts are isolated from the input power and the dry contact input, enabling them to be wired to switch any other power-load or low-voltage load.

Rib® dry contact input relay rib02sbcdc enclosed 208-277vac 20a spdt override the dry contact input rib series offers all the advantages of the standard rib line; plus it can be activated by a wide range of dry-contacts such as thermostats switches other relays solid-state switches etc. The dry contact input rib provides the low-voltage (class 2) power needed to activate the relay (self-powered) - just close the dry-contact input. The power to energize the relay can be brought to the relay on a separate pair of wires along with the control output of the controller or can be a local power source near the relay. The relay contacts are isolated from the input power and the dry contact input; thus they can be wired to switch any other power-load or low-voltage load (see specifications for contact ratings). One model can be used for many installations (model rib21cdc can operate from any voltage from 120vac - 277vac; see specifications for the input power of other models).
